The Senate and the League of Nations, a book chronicling the Senate's deliberations on the Treaty of Versailles, was published in 1925 by Senator Henry Cabot Lodge.

Why did senators oppose the League of Nations' membership?

Republicans were concerned that joining the League would tie the US to an expensive organization and make it more difficult for the US to defend its own interests, so Lodge led the League opposition.

The League of Nations was opposed by which senators?

Republicans George W. Norris of Nebraska, William Borah of Idaho, Robert La Follette of Wisconsin, and Hiram Johnson of California were among the major Irreconcilables. Democrats included the Massachusetts-based Irish Catholic leader David I. Walsh and senators Thomas Gore of Oklahoma and James Reed of Missouri.

One of the key factors in the Philadelphia Constitutional Convention's being called was the Shays Rebellion. The tax protest proved that, in accordance with the Articles of Confederation, the federal authority was powerless to put down an internal uprising.

The Shays' Rebellion was an armed uprising in Western Massachusetts and Worcester caused by a debt issue among the citizenry as well as opposition to the state government's increased efforts to tax people and their professions.

Shays's Rebellion exposed the shortcomings of Articles of Confederation government and led many, including George Washington, to argue for bolstering federal power to put an end to any future uprisings.

Shay's Rebellion focused on the limitation of the Articles. When the national government failed to put an end to the rebellion, the first indications of federalism grew stronger.

One of the pinnacles of French art from the 17th century, the Palace of Versailles has been on the World Heritage List for 40 years. When Louis XIV moved the Court and government there in 1682, he refurbished and expanded his father Louis XIII's ancient hunting pavilion.

Louis XIV's method for consolidating power.

Louis XIV consolidated his power by selecting capable, obedient ministers, expanding the scope of the intendant system, reforming civil and criminal legislation, expanding the army, and relocating the nobles to Versailles Palace where they lived alongside him.

What is the case of Hammer v. Dagenhart (1918) about?

The case titled "Hammer v. Dagenhart" was a United States Supreme Court decision in which the Court struck down a federal law regulating child labor. The case decision was overruled by the case of United States v. Darby Lumber Co. Here, the Supreme Court held that the Commerce Clause does not grant the power to regulate commerce of interstate commerce of goods produced with child labor.

What is the case of United States v. Lopez (1995) about?

The case titled "United States v. Alfonso D. Lopez" was a United States Supreme Court decision concerning the Commerce Clause, it was the first case since 1937 in which the Court held that Congress had exceeded its power to legislate under the Commerce Clause.

To initiate an armed insurrection of slaves and end the practice of slavery, abolitionist John Brown leads a small party on a raid against a government arsenal in Harpers Ferry, Vi/rginia (now West Vir/ginia).

Who is Abolitionist John Brown?

Generally, John Brown was an American abolitionist who lived from May 9, 1800, until December 2, 1859.

He first rose to national attention for his extreme abolitionism and participation in Bleeding Kansas, but he was ultimately apprehended and killed for trying to stir a slave uprising at Harpers Ferry before the American Civil War.

Who were the Black Union Soilders?

In the American Civil War, a sizable number of African Americans/ black union soilders fought. Seven,122 officers and 178,975 enlisted soldiers made up the 186,097 black males who enlisted in the Union Army. About 20,000 black sailors served in the Union Navy and made up a sizable portion of the crews on numerous ships.

Hence, Any caught Black Union Soldiers would face an immediate execution or sale into slavery, warnings that the Confederate authority occasionally carried out. When black soldiers were killed or made slaves in response, Lincoln threatened to take revenge against Confederate prisoners.
